did you read any facts about the centrino in the advertisements. The centrino isn't the processor it's the combination of the Pentium Mobile processor and certain wireless technologies. Notice I said Pentium M not P3 M or P4 M. It's the latest pentium mobile processor, It comes in speeds ranging from 1.3ghz to 1.7ghz (i think). It's very fast for it's clock speed, not quite as fast as the Pentium 4's but comes close. The main point of attraction is the battery life, with certain power saving functions enabled, you can squeeze more than 6 hours worth of power from a single normal laptop battery. Now do you any 3.2ghz HT P4 that can last 6 hours in a laptop. By the way centrino laptops weigh considerably less than the equivalent P4 and also cost less.(usually).
